Lower Back Pain, Lower Stomach Pain, Stiff Neck. Taking Muscle Relaxers, Steroids. Advice?

yes I have been having very bad lower back pain that has now moved down my right leg and it feel like it is in the lower right side of my stomach as well. No medication has helped the pain is very bad. Now my neck has gotten stiff and it hurts really bad what is going on. I have muscle relaxers, pain meds, and I have also taken steroids but nothing. Do I need to go back to my doctor this has been 3 weeks now stiff neck one day.

Orthopaedic Surgeon 's  Response
Hello,

I have studied your case.

As per your symptoms neck pain can be due to diffuse disc bulge compressing your cervical spine.

You may need MRI spine to see for severity of nerve compression.
Some medication like methylcobalamine with muscle relaxant and analgesic will reduce pain, you can take them consulting your treating doctor.
You may consult physiotherapist for further guidance. He may start TENS ,or ultrasound which is helpful in your case.


If no relief with medication then you may need surgical decompression
